Optimizing for Search Engines
Once your website is visually appealing and contains compelling content, it’s time to optimize it for search engines. Here are a few SEO techniques to boost your website’s visibility:
2.1 Keyword Research
Start by conducting thorough keyword research to discover the terms and phrases your target audience is searching for.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ner or SEMrush to identify relevant keywords in the beauty and salon industry, and incorporate them strategically in your website’s content, meta tags, and image alt text to improve your search engine rankings.
2.2 On-Page SEO
Optimize your website’s pages and blog posts for search engines by implementing on-page SEO best practices. This includes optimizing title tags, meta descriptions, headers (H1, H2, H3), and URLs. Don’t forget to optimize images by using descriptive filenames and alt text, as search engines also consider visuals when ranking websites.
Utilizing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ising
Paid advertising is another effective way to boost your salon’s online presence. Pay-Per-Click (PPC) advertising allows you to target specific keywords and demographics, ensuring your ads are seen by potential customers. Here’s how you can make the most of it:
3.1 Targeted Keyword Campaigns
Set up PPC campaigns targeting relevant keywords in the beauty and salon industry. Conduct extensive keyword research to identify popular search terms used by potential customers in your locality. Create compelling ad copy that highlights your salon’s unique selling points and encourages users to click on your ads.
3.2 Social Media Advertising
Social media platforms provide a great opportunity for beauty salons to reach a broader audience through highly targeted advertising. Create visually appealing ad visuals that align with your brand’s aesthetics, and use demographic targeting options to narrow down your audience. Monitor the performance of your ads and adjust targeting based on conversions and engagement.

Leveraging Influencer Marketing
Influencer marketing has become a powerful tool in the beauty industry. Collaborating with relevant influencers can help increase brand awareness and attract new customers. Here’s how you can make the most of influencer partnerships:
4.1 Identifying Suitable Influencers
Identify influencers who align with your brand’s values and have a strong following in the beauty industry. Look for influencers who have an engaged audience and produce high-quality content. Reach out to them with a personalized message outlining the mutual benefits of collaboration.
4.2 Collaborating for Better Results
Maximize the impact of your influencer campaigns by ensuring clear communication and setting realistic expectations from the beginning. Provide influencers with creative freedom while maintaining brand guidelines. Track the performance of influencer campaigns through metrics like engagement rates, website visits, or conversions to evaluate their effectiveness.
